    Kathy Kolbe is a pioneering theorist on the conative part of the mind, emphasizing the significance of instinctive problem-solving approaches. As a dyslexic person, Kathy has challenged traditional testing methods and shed light on the natural creativity and strategic skills of individuals. Her work led to the development of the Kolbe Index, a valuable tool for understanding conative strengths and enhancing personal and business relationships. Kathy also emphasizes the importance of trusting instincts, valuing different problem-solving methods, and promoting self-awareness and communication skills.

  • André, The Impulsive Thinker, welcomes ADHD expert Dr. Ari Tuckman for an insightful exploration of time blindness and its impact on ADHD Entrepreneurs. Ari breaks down the concept of temporal discounting, explaining how delayed consequences feel less pressing in the present. André openly shares his struggles with long-term projects and financial planning. Ari provides practical strategies for making time visible, setting interim deadlines, and externalizing tasks to stay accountable.
